Transaction 18063295e6ae90459aa67e263a3c06d80adae1a0c338a1c1a92d25ce80e1a71c
1 Input
1 Output
-
18063295e6ae90459aa67e263a3c06d80adae1a0c338a1c1a92d25ce80e1a71c:0
- value
- 21680
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 837eb10018369752749420f22fc5e80a231197f934136247f2fe51482e621c11
- address
- ltc1psdltzqqcx6t4yay5yrezl30gpg33r9lexsfky3ljleg5stnzrsgsngttx8